Improvement of image quality of time-domain diffuse optical tomography with l(p) sparsity regularization

An l(p) (0 < p ≤ 1) sparsity regularization is applied to time-domain diffuse optical tomography with a gradient-based nonlinear optimization scheme to improve the spatial resolution and the robustness to noise.
